Boys golf: Oak Harbor places 3rd in final regular season match

Finishing up the 2011 regular season, the Oak Harbor High School boys golf team placed third in a four-team match at Kenwanda Friday, April 29.
Host Glacier Peak easily won the match with 197 strokes. Lynnwood edged Oak Harbor by one stroke, 237-238, for second while Mountlake Terrace finished at 259.
Judd Ford paced the Wildcats with a 40 on the 35-par course, good for fourth overall. Greg Martin shot a 41, Caleb Knaack 49, David Bunch 53, Quinton Wallace 55 and Jake Nelson 56.
Connor Denessen of Glacier Peak was medalist at 37.
Oak Harbor will go to the Snohomish Golf Course for the Wesco 3A championship tournament Tuesday and Wednesday, May 10 and 11, at noon.
